Demerger Agreement means the agreement in relation to the Demerger to be entered into by Codan Forsikring, Tryg Regulated Company and NewCo immediately prior to the execution of the Demerger Plan and shall contain a cross-indemnification relating to statutory demerger liability pursuant to section 254(2) of the Danish Companies Act pursuant to which Tryg Regulated Company shall indemnify NewCo for Demerger Claims made against NewCo which relate to the Tryg Perimeter and NewCo shall indemnify Tryg Regulated Company for Demerger Claims made against Tryg Regulated Company which relate to the CodanDK Perimeter and further and on a secondary basis: (a) Tryg shall indemnify NewCo for all Demerger Claims against NewCo if such Demerger Claims relate to the Tryg Perimeter; and (b) Intact (only 50% of the demerger liability) shall indemnify Tryg Regulated Company for all Demerger Claims against Tryg Regulated Company if such Demerger Claims relate to the CodanDK Perimeter;
